Top Digital Marketing Strategies For Dentist

Digital Marketing For Dentist

Now that you know why digital marketing is so crucial for dentists, let’s look at some of the best tactics for growing your practice online.

1. Design and development of a website

In today’s digital world, each dental business must have a website. A well-designed and user-friendly website may assist dentists in promoting their services, informing prospective patients, and establishing reputation. A website should be simple to browse and created with the user in mind. The website should also be search engine optimized so that it shows in search engine results pages (SERPs).

2. SEO (Search Engine Optimization)

SEO is the practice of improving a website to rank better in search engine results pages (SERPs). Keyword research, on-page optimization, link development, and content production are all part of SEO. SEO may assist dentists in increasing their exposure and attracting more visitors to their websites. SEO may also assist dentists in establishing their influence in their specialties.

3. PPC (pay-per-click) advertising

PPC advertising is putting ads on search engines or social media platforms and paying for each click. PPC advertising may assist dentists in rapidly and successfully reaching their target demographic. Dentists may use keywords, demographics, and geography to target their adverts. PPC advertising might be expensive, but it can also provide immediate results.

4. Social Media Promotion

Social media marketing entails reaching out to a target audience using social media plat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ram. Social media marketing may assist dentists in increasing brand recognition, engaging patients, and promoting their services. Dentists may utilize social media to post material, hold competitions, and promote their services.

5. Email Promotion

Sending emails to a list of subscribers is what email marketing is all about. Email marketing may assist dentists in staying in contact with their patients, promoting their services, and providing promotions. Dentists may utilize email marketing to deliver essential information to their patients, such as oral health recommendations and information about innovative dental procedures.

6. Video Promotion

Video marketing entails developing and distributing videos that advertise the services of a dental office. Dentists may use video marketing to highlight their services, offer instructional information, and develop reputation. Videos may be posted on social media, YouTube, and the website of a dental clinic.

Dentist Content Marketing

Digital Marketing For Dentist

The process of developing and distributing excellent information that attracts and engages a target audience is known as content marketing. Dentists may use content marketing to increase brand recognition, establish reputation, and attract new patients. Dentists may utilize the following content marketing strategies:

1. Writing a Blog

Blogging entails writing and posting blog articles on the website of a dental office. Blogging may help dentists share their knowledge, offer instructive material, and enhance the SEO of their website. Blog postings might include information on dental treatments, oral health, and patient feedback.

2. Infographics

Data and information are represented visually in infographics. Infographics may assist dentists in communicating difficult information in a simple and entertaining manner. Infographics may be disseminated on social media, the website of a dental clinic, and other online channels.

3. E-books

E-books are longer-form content items that give detailed information on a particular subject. E-books may be used to highlight a dentistry practice’s competence while also providing vital information to prospective patients. E-books may be advertised on the website and social media of a dental office.

4. Webinars

Webinars are online seminars that enable dentists to share their knowledge and educate a bigger audience. Webinars may be used to market a dental office’s services and to position the firm as an industry expert.

5. Podcasts

Podcasts are audio recordings that may be downloaded and listened to whenever it is convenient for you. Podcasts may be used to disseminate instructional information, expert interviews, and patient testimonies. Podcasts may be promoted on the website and social media of a dental office.

6. Case Studies

Case studies are detailed examinations of individual patient cases. Case studies may be utilized to highlight a dentistry practice’s competence while also providing vital information to prospective patients. Case studies may be presented on the website and social media of a dental office.

Dentist Reputation Management

Digital Marketing For Dentist

Monitoring and maintaining a dental practice’s internet reputation is part of reputation management. Dentists must manage their reputation to ensure that their practice seems credible and trustworthy to prospective patients. Dentists may employ the following reputation management strategies:

1. Online Reviews

Online reviews play an important role in a dental practice’s online reputation. Patients should be encouraged to post reviews on Google, Yelp, and other online review sites by their dentists. Dentists should also reply to both good and negative evaluations to demonstrate that they care about their patients’ experiences.

2. Local Listings

Online directories that give information about local companies, including dentistry offices, are known as local listings. Dentists should make sure their practice is listed in local directories like Google My Business, Yelp, and Healthgrades. Dentists might benefit from local listings to boost their exposure and attract more patients.

3. Google My Business

Google My Business is a free online platform that enables dentists to manage their Google presence, including search and maps. Google My Business allows dentists to update their office information, reply to reviews, and make changes.

4. Monitoring of Social Media

Dentists should keep an eye on their social media profiles and reply to comments and messages in a timely and professional way. Social media monitoring may assist dentists in improving their online reputation and gaining the confidence of future patients.

Dentist Metrics to Monitor

Digital Marketing For Dentist

Metrics are critical for dentists to track the performance of their digital marketing campaigns. Dentists should monitor the following metrics:

1. Website Traffic

Dentists should monitor their website traffic to determine the amount of visits. Dentists should also monitor the sources of their website visitors to discover which marketing tactics are most effective.

2. Conversion Rate

The proportion of website visitors who complete a certain activity, such as scheduling an appointment or filling out a contact form, is referred to as the conversion rate. Dentists should monitor the efficiency of their website and marketing activities by tracking their conversion rate.

3. Online Reviews

Dentists should check their internet reputation and patient satisfaction by tracking their online reviews. Positive reviews may assist a dental clinic attract new customers, whilst bad reviews can undermine the business’s reputation.

4. Social Media Engagement

Dentists should assess the efficacy of their social media operations by tracking their social media interaction. Likes, comments, and shares on social media postings are examples of social media engagement.

5. ROI (Return on Investment)

Dentists should assess the performance of their digital marketing strategies by tracking their ROI. ROI compares the amount of income earned by a marketing effort to the amount invested on that campaign.

FAQs

1. How long does it take to get benefits from dental digital marketing?

Significant effects from internet marketing initiatives might take many months. Dentists should, however, analyze their analytics on a regular basis to gauge success and make improvements to their campaigns as appropriate.

2. What are some good sponsored dental advertising strategies?

Google Ads, Facebook Ads, and Instagram Ads are all successful paid advertising techniques for dentists.

3. What steps may dentists take to enhance their internet reputation?

Dentists may enhance their online image by encouraging patients to submit reviews, responding to reviews in a timely and professional way, and maintaining a close eye on their social media profiles.

4. How often should dentists use social media?

Dentists should publish on social media on a regular basis, although the frequency will vary depending on the platform and the audience. A basic rule of thumb is to publish at least once every day on sites such as Facebook and Instagram.

5. Should dentists tackle digital marketing on their own or engage a professional?

While dentists may handle certain parts of digital marketing on their own, including as social media administration and content development, it is generally advantageous to employ a professional digital marketing firm to handle more complicated methods, such as SEO and paid advertising.
